Little Rock, AR Weather on August 12
August 12th in Little Rock, AR typically brings hot summer weather, with average highs around 92°F and lows near 72°F. Over 55 years of records, the warmest August 12th was in 2007 (91°F average), while the coldest was 2004 (70°F) — a 21°F range across recorded history. Rain or other precipitation has occurred on about 22% of August 12th dates historically, with the wettest August 12th recording 1.48" of rain. The last decade has been 2.6°F warmer on this date compared to 20-30 years ago.
